#### Phase 1: Preparation
1. Asset Inventory Baseline: Establish current asset records and identify gaps
2. Tool Selection: Choose appropriate hardware audit technology and methodology
3. Team Training: Prepare manufacturing staff for audit execution
4. Communication Plan: Notify stakeholders and affected teams
#### Phase 2: Discovery
1. Automated Scanning: Deploy discovery tools across manufacturing infrastructure
2. Manual Verification: Validate automated findings with physical inspection
3. Data Reconciliation: Compare discovered assets with existing records
4. Gap Analysis: Identify missing, unknown, or misconfigured assets
#### Phase 3: Documentation
1. Asset Classification: Categorize assets by type, criticality, and ownership
2. Compliance Mapping: Document regulatory and policy compliance status
3. Risk Assessment: Evaluate security and operational risks for each asset
4. Report Generation: Create comprehensive hardware audit documentation
